Answer:
girls = 125
boys = 87
Step-by-step explanation:
Total number of students in the 8th grade class = 212
Let g represent girls and b represent boys
Number of girls, g = 2b -49
Note that boys and girls in the class give a total of 212
So,
g + b = 212 ....eq 1
Slot in the value of g in the equation
2b - 49 + b = 212
2b + b - 49 = 212
3b - 49 = 212
Add 49 to both sides
3b - 49 + 49 = 212 + 49
3b = 261
Divide both sides by the coefficient of b which is 3
b = 87
Now that we've found the number of boys, let's find that of girls
We will slot in the value of b in eq 1
g + 87 = 212
Subtract 87 from both sides
g + 87 - 87 = 212 - 87
g = 125
So the number of boys is 87 and the number of girls is 125
